Given a sinusoidal function (sine function or cos function) in the form

y = A Cos (Bx), we can say that A is the amplitude.

Amplitude defines the function's maximum and minimum.

The maximum of this form of function is A and the minimum is -A.

The function given is y = -Cos(8x), so A is -1

Thus, maximum value is 1 and minimum value is -1.
